Transaction ca1d79a55564866423717608b0d6c21e161037b088a7af98ad3498c5ed2f8fe5
2 Input
2 Outputs
- ca1d79a55564866423717608b0d6c21e161037b088a7af98ad3498c5ed2f8fe5:0
- ca1d79a55564866423717608b0d6c21e161037b088a7af98ad3498c5ed2f8fe5:1
value 2834506
address 1GMMrPgFsfZhamMZ8CCsd7KTH2xoofpumM
value 1407918
address 3DvzNkf9YXD5YicXXtZcLn8932xRrHrELG